Steering problem
2006 Chevy Lumina 6 cyl Automatic 59105 miles

I have this car since one year I bought with mileage 47000. I notice since few months, first time I was taking a left turn with littlie push paddle and feel got no control its like sliding so I pull my hand from steering it come normal and start it s happen several time in deferent place, but now if I m on stop light and after green signal when start littlie hard push paddle it also same its like sliding like I am on ice.
also notice like tire jam if stop pushing my paddle it calm and normal.
my tire condition is good, now I am afraid to drive with this situation.

wow, it sounds like one of your tierod ends is not connected to the control arm, you must have someone take a look immediately before driving again.
